Q: Is 235,179 a Prime Number?
A: No, 235,179 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 235179 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 9 21 63 3,733 11,199 26,131 33,597 78,393 and 235,179, with no remainder.
Since 235,179 cannot be divided by just 1 and 235,179, it is not a prime number.
